Indian refineries, especially those owned by private companies, are designed to process Persian crude, which is qualitatively different from Arabian crude. For India to suddenly switch from Persian to Arabian crude, expensive re-fitting of the refineries will have to be performed. Who pays?

The downtime required to re-fit the refineries will cause oil prices will shoot up drastically in a large oil-consumption market such as India’s. It will worsen the steep inflation already troubling the country’s economy.

Lastly, India is not stupid. An anticipated American pull-out from Afghanistan will require India to develop closer relations with Iran and Russia, to ensure that the former Northern Alliance (which took over Afghanistan after the Taliban were deposed) stays in power, instead of what will be an obvious restoration of the Taliban by Pakistan.

In other words, India won’t budge from doing what it sees are for its interests. With America supporting, aiding and enabling suicidal Islamist regimes like those of Saudi Arabia and Pakistan, India won’t have a very difficult choice to make in rejecting American concerns.
